For a long time, a formal rapprochement between Saudi Arabia and Israel seemed all but impossible. In recent months, there have been signs that the two sides are reaching out to each other. But now Saudi Arabia is stopping the talks, according to diplomatic circles.

Saudi Arabia has stopped talks on a possible normalization of relations with Israel. The German Press Agency claims to have learned this from Saudi diplomatic circles. The talks were brokered by the US. Saudi Arabia is considered an important protector of the Palestinians.


In the immediate aftermath of Hamas' large-scale attack a week ago, and because of Israel's expected response, fears had already arisen that Saudi Arabia might draw consequences for talks on normalizing relations with Israel.


Saudi Arabia on Friday sharply criticized a call by the Israeli military for the mass evacuation of the northern Gaza Strip. The kingdom rejects the "forced relocation", the Foreign Ministry announced. All forms of military escalation directed against civilians must be stopped.

US Secretary of State Antony Blinken is currently in the Saudi capital Riyadh. He is due to meet his Saudi counterpart Faisal bin Farhan this Saturday.
